Consider timing your lowlight service strategically with the changing seasons. Adding deeper tones in autumn can help shift your summer look to a richer fall palette, while subtle lowlights in spring can add depth without darkening your overall look too dramatically. Always consult with a qualified colorist who can evaluate your hair's condition and recommend the most suitable lowlight placement and shades for your desired outcome. They'll guarantee the process is performed safely, using quality products that minimize damage and maximize the longevity of your color. With proper application and care, lowlights can enhance your natural beauty while maintaining the health and integrity of your hai
You'll find that lowlights offer extraordinary versatility in achieving your desired look. They can be applied in various shades, typically one to two levels darker than your natural or current hair color. This careful selection guarantees the results appear natural rather than striped or artificial. When properly executed, lowlights can slim a round face, add sophistication to a basic cut, or create the illusion of thicker, more voluminous hai

Proper body positioning plays a vital role in maintaining control during cuts. You should position yourself with feet shoulder-width apart, keeping your cutting elbow close to your body to minimize fatigue and enhance stability.
